“It's Nice to Have a Real Deli in a Small Town”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ed August 6, 2012

The Main Street Deli in Chambersburg is like something that you'd find in downtown New York City. They offer sandwiches, soups, quiche, and salads. I had a turkey sandwich of some kind with artichoke and honey mustard on it, and i'd definitely order it again! I also had a small caesar salad for $3.99, and it was really big! Usually, side salads are small and don't have much taste, but that wasn't the case! The crab soup is really tasty too. The only thing to criticize is the decor, which is really old and drab. The outside really needs painted. This is a great option for a light lunch in Chambersburg!

“Love this place!”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ed July 7, 2012

Whether it's stopping in for a quick bite with some girlfriends or just grabbing lunch, this is my favorite spot in Chambersburg. Their crab bisque is amazing, and I am also a fan of their lettuce-less salad. All their sandwiches are also wonderful. You can't lose here.

“Best Crab Soup!!”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ed January 30, 2012

Main Street Deli is a bright spot in downtown Chambersburg. Personal service with a cozy feel. Great specialty sandwiches. My favorite is "a bird to the wise" with a combination of their special chicken salad on raisin bread. Yummy Crab soup will keep you coming back for more.

I also used their catering services for the weddings of each of my daughters & was very pleased with both the food & presentation.

“Homemade - and you can tell!”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ed December 22, 2011

I don't get to get out to Main Street Deli too often, but any chance I get, I go! I was just recently there for breakfast with my wife. The building itself is pretty old and the decor is nothing special. Everything seems a little run down.

But....that is where the bad things stop! It don't decide whether I like a restaurant or not based on the decor, but rather based on the food, service, and cleanliness! I can tell you from my experience that all 3 are top notch!

The menu is your typical deli style and the food was excellent and very fresh. I had the roasted red pepper and mushroom quiche. It was served with some bread and two thin slices of apples. The quiche itself was wonderful! It was piping hot and ooey gooey good! It almost melted in my mouth. The crust on it was flaky and light. My wife had the crab quiche and that was also excellent - although it was very crabby (in a good way). We also split a fresh fruit salad and actually had to wait for it because they were in the process of cutting the fruit. If definitely tasted like it was fresh. We both had coffee and neither of our glasses were ever empty.

The cleanliness. Not much to say here. The tables and floors were clean and free of debris. I didn't see any bugs! I did not use the rest room so I can not comment on that.

The service was wonderful. My wife arrived a couple minutes before I did and she already had coffee waiting for me when I arrived. Within minutes, our server asked if we were ready and we had not looked at the menu yet. She politely asked if we would like to hear what quiches they had today and then, after she told us, she let us alone. She did not come back too fast to take our order (feels like pressuring us), nor did she take a long time to come back. After ordering we waited about 10 minutes for our food. She checked back to make sure everything was okay and it seemed like we did not hear from her again until we needed our bill. Which, by the way, she was right there when we were ready!

Overall, this is a very quiet, yet busy, little deli/restaurant which I hope will thrive for many years. Together, we spend less than $20 for a very filling breakfast in which we never felt any pressure to hurry. It was nice to actually get to sit and talk for a bit in today's hectic world.

“my favorite Chambersburg lunch spot”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ed July 29, 2011

This place is my first choice for a non-chain lunch spot. My favorite sandwich is A Bird To The Wise, a triple-layer of toasted raisin bread filled with chicken salad made with pineapple and, I think, some kind of nuts (almonds or walnuts, I would guess). Anyway, you don't analyze the ingredients, you just think, "yummm!". There's no pressure from the staff to finish and move on, so it's a great place to meet a friend and chat.
